A train trip from Glossop to Liverpool Lime Street takes about 1hrs 39 mins on average, covering roughly 42 miles (68 kilometres). With around 33 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£6.10,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Glossop Station welcomes passengers with a range of facilities designed to improve your travel experience. The ticket office operates with generous hours, welcoming visitors from early in the morning until late in the evening on weekdays. It also maintains a presence on Sundays, albeit with shorter hours. A convenient ticket machine is available for collecting pre-purchased tickets and is accessible for all travelers, including wheelchair users. For tech-savvy travelers, smartcards are also an option at this station.
Those requiring assistance will find ample support, with staff available during most operating hours. Step-free access throughout the station speaks to its commitment to inclusivity. For travelers needing just a little extra help, you can arrange assistance in advance, using the convenient Passenger Assist service. As you step into Liverpool Lime Street, you'll find a station that provides a wealth of services to make your journey more pleasant. The ticket office is open from early morning until late night, accommodating the schedules of early birds and night owls alike. With eight accessible ticket machines sprinkled throughout the station and facilities for collecting tickets purchased online, buying your ticket is straightforward. Moreover, the station caters for travelers with disabilities, offering step-free access across the platform, accessible toilets, and wheelchairs on request.
For those who seek refreshments or a quick shopping spree, the station hosts various retail outlets and dining facilities. Although it doesn’t have an ATM or currency exchange, it’s equipped with payphones and free Wi-Fi, keeping you connected on-the-go. If you're cycling your way around the city, cycle racks and storage are available by the Lord Nelson and Skelhorne Street entrances.
A journey through Liverpool is not complete without taking advantage of its exemplary transport connections. From Liverpool Lime Street, you can board rail replacement services or taxis on Skelhorne Street. Buses, run by Arriva and Stagecoach, provide frequent and convenient connections to the rest of Liverpool and neighboring towns. For those flying in or out of Liverpool, it's an easy connection by bus to Liverpool ONE bus station and then onto the 500 Airport Flyer to Liverpool John Lennon Airport.
